Why Blue-Collar Talent Is in High Demand in 2025

Europe’s labor shortages are growing for many reasons:

  • Aging workforce

  • Decline in younger workers entering skilled trades

  • Increased industrial and construction projects

  • Growth in logistics and transportation industries

Because of these factors, employers urgently need responsible workers in many sectors.


Top Blue-Collar Jobs for Employers in Europe

1. Construction Workers & Skilled Tradespeople

Construction remains one of the highest-demand sectors in Europe. Major projects in infrastructure, housing, and commercial development create a constant need for skilled labor.

Key Roles in Construction

  • Electricians

  • Plumbers

  • Welders

  • Carpenters

  • Scaffolders

  • Heavy machine operators

  • General laborers

These jobs offer good salaries, training options, and long-term contracts.


2. Drivers & Transport Workers

Europe’s logistics industry is expanding fast, especially with the rise of eCommerce.

Most Needed Driving Jobs

  • Truck drivers (HGV/LGV)

  • Delivery drivers

  • Bus drivers

  • Taxi and ride-hailing drivers

Foreign workers with clean records and valid licenses are highly valued.


3. Manufacturing & Factory Workers

Factories across Europe need workers to operate machinery, package goods, and maintain production lines.

Common Factory Roles

  • Machine operators

  • Production assistants

  • Assembly line workers

  • Quality check staff

These jobs are popular among foreign job seekers because they require basic training and offer stable shifts.


4. Warehouse & Logistics Staff

Warehousing plays a key role in the European supply chain.

Roles in Logistics & Supply Chain

  • Pickers & packers

  • Forklift operators

  • Inventory supervisors

  • Shipping/receiving workers

These roles are in high demand due to fast-moving global trade and distribution networks.


5. Hospitality & Cleaning Staff

Hotels, restaurants, and cleaning companies rely heavily on blue-collar workers.

Positions in Hotels & Facilities

  • Housekeepers

  • Janitors

  • Dishwashers

  • Waitstaff

  • Kitchen helpers

These jobs often include accommodation and meals, making them ideal for foreign workers.


6. Agriculture & Farm Workers

Seasonal and year-round farm work remains a major opportunity in Europe.

Seasonal and Long-Term Roles

  • Fruit pickers

  • Livestock workers

  • Greenhouse workers

  • Tractor operators

These jobs are especially popular in Spain, Italy, Germany, and the Netherlands.
